攘羊
rǎng​yáng

to steal a sheep

Definitions Defs Origin Strokes Stroke Words Sentences Sents
攘羊 rǎng//yáng
to steal a sheep
(literary) to take home someone else's stray sheep; to steal a sheep
to expose a relative's fault
(literary) to expose or testify against a family member's wrongdoing. This sense refers to a story from the 论语 lún​yǔ where a son reports his father for stealing a sheep.
